
3. Curio Shop
Category – Literature
The Manhattan antique shop owned by Trouble’s parents is called “The Old Curio Shop.” That name is a tribute to The Old Curiosity Shop. Built in 1567, it’s still open for business. You can see a photo of the shop as it looks today at the Pictures of England website –

This London store inspired a novel (The Old Curiosity Shop) written by the famous author Charles Dickens. In Dickens’ lifetime, his stories appeared in British newspapers. The novels were serialized, printed one chapter at a time. This is like having daily entries in today’s Internet blogs. Charles Dickens had a wide audience of readers, from humble chimney sweeps to Queen Victoria. A family gathered together and read the latest chapter, wondering what would happen next in the story. Dickens specialized in writing about orphans, shopkeepers and criminals.
